Red Grapes Panna Cotta

Ingredients:


For Panna Cotta :


1 cup milk

1 cup fresh cream

1/2 tbsp gelatin

2 tbsp cold water

1/4 cup sugar

1 tsp vanilla essence


For Red Grapes Layer :


250-300 gm red grapes

1/4 cup sugar

2 tsp gelatin

2 tbsp cold water


Preparation:


For Panna Cotta :


  1. Dissolve gelatin in 2 tbsp cold water and leave it for 5-10 minutes.
  2. In a sauce pan, bring the cream, milk and sugar to a simmer over medium- low heat. Do not boil.
  3. Remove from the flame when sugar has dissolved. Then add vanilla essence and the gelatin in the milk mixture and stir until the gelatin has completely dissolved.
  4. Pour into serving glasses or ramekins and refrigerate until it sets, for about 2-4 hours.


For Red Grapes Layer :


  1. Wash the red grapes thoroughly and boil it in a pan / vessel adding about 1 1/2 cup of water until the skin of the grapes begins to break. Switch off the flame and then leave it to cool.
  2. In a blender, add the cooled grapes along with its juice and blend well. Strain it through a strainer and keep it aside.
  3. Place 2 tbsp cold water in a small bowl and sprinkle over the gelatin and leave it for 5 minutes or until the gelatin absorbs the water.
  4. In a sauce pan, add the prepared red grapes juice and sugar and simmer until the sugar has dissolved.
  5. Then add the gelatin and cook, stirring, for 1 minute or just until gelatin has dissolved.
  6. Remove from the flame and allow to cool to room temperature.
  7. Pour it over the chilled panna cotta and refrigerate for 4 hours or until set. Serve chilled....
